As discussed during the dispatch call, police responded to a domestic disturbance near Franklin Street in Worcester. A caller reported that her adult son was acting aggressively, breaking and throwing items during a mental health crisis. Officers discussed dispatching crisis intervention and emergency medical services, which initially had no available units.
